  1. Be Clear About Your Budget

Bridesmaid dresses can vary significantly in price. So whether you’re covering the cost yourself or having the girls purchase them, it’s still important to keep the price in mind.

If you’re paying, come up with an overall budget for this aspect of your wedding and divide it by the number of girls in the party. This number will be how much you should aim to spend per dress at most. Keep in mind this number doesn’t take alterations or other aspects of their outfit into account.

If the bridesmaids will be paying, try to ask around and see what budget everyone will be comfortable with. You don’t want someone in your wedding to get stretched too thin. Most of the time, it’s easy to find a number that everyone agrees with and find a beautiful dress for everyone.

  1. Keep Your Venue in Mind

Do you have a unique venue? Are there a lot of stairs? Are there colors in the room that might clash with specific colors?

You should take your venue into account when choosing the dresses. Think about the colors of the space and what color dresses will look nice with them.

You want your photos to look great, whether they’re taken during the ceremony or throughout the reception, so it’s crucial to consider this before landing on a dress.

You also want to consider logistical issues as well. If the venue has a lot of stairs, will a long dress end up tripping someone? Thinking about little details like this makes a big difference in the end!

  1. Don’t Procrastinate

One of the worst things you can do when preparing for a wedding is procrastinating when it comes to ordering dresses. So whether it’s your wedding dress options or bridesmaid dresses, try to choose one and order it well ahead of time.

It’s a good idea to double-check with someone and see how long shipping takes to ensure things will get to you on time. If you plan on having alterations done, check and see how long this will take as well. You might need to have the dresses arrive sooner than you think.

Remember too that it’s wise to take shipping delays into account. Most of the time, expected arrival dates are estimates and not guarantees. So if you’re down to the wire, you might end up paying extra for faster shipping or dealing with the stress of wondering if the dresses will arrive on time.

Ordering them and having them arrive in a time frame well before you need them to come is a great way to avoid any of these pitfalls.

  1. Pick Simple Fabrics

It’s understandable if you want to go all out and get a fully sequined dress for your bridesmaids to strut in, but this can lead to issues down the line.

The more intricate the fabric and design, the more expensive any alterations will be. And these types of materials often don’t photograph well or distract from the most important dress—the bride’s gown.

Opting for simple, yet beautiful, fabrics is crucial. This will also help ensure the dress is comfortable to wear. There’s nothing worse than itchy, restricting, or generally uncomfortable fabrics that distract bridesmaids from enjoying the day.

  1. Keep Movement in Mind

Picking simple fabrics is also the best option when considering movement. Your bridesmaids will be walking down the aisle before you, posing for photos, sitting to eat, and dancing the night away with you!

All of this movement will be much easier if the material is comfortable, they don’t feel too exposed, and they feel confident overall in the dress they’re wearing.

  1. Think About How Photos Will Look

Throughout this whole article, we’ve touched on how keeping certain things in mind will help make sure your photos turn out great.

It’s still important to think about this aspect on its own before finalizing any dress options. If your bridesmaids are all picking their own dresses, try having them pose next to one another to see how they match. If this isn’t possible, at least have photos of the dresses side-by-side to compare.

A good rule of thumb is to stick within the same color family. For example, blush and burgundy go well together because they’re both a variation of pink. From here, try to make sure everyone gets the same dress length.

If you follow these two rules, everything should go smoothly and pair nicely.
